Job description

Job Title: -Warehouse Associate

Job type: 12 months

Work type: Onsite

Salary: £12.23 per Hour

Location: Dundee

Working mode: Monday-Friday

Main Purpose of Job

  • This is an individual contributor role with expectations aligned to the Capabilities and Behaviours as set out in the Employee Handbook.
  • Within the Dundee Operations environment, the Warehouse Associate is responsible for preparing product for shipment to final destination

Accountabilities

  • Conducting all activities in accordance with the Health & Safety culture
  • Responsible to comply with Division policies and procedures, ISO applicable requirements and with GMP regulations and requirements
  • Routine material handling tasks related to the receipt, movement and shipment of materials and Finished goods
  • Provides standard clerical and administrative support for the billing and shipping functions including photocopying, filing and maintaining records of shipments
  • Pick, assemble and verify customer orders ready for distribution, arranging transport as necessary
  • For goods considered dangerous for transport, assemble goods and prepare documentation to ensure compliance against international and national regulations (ADR / IATA)
  • Providing effective contribution to the Dundee Logistics Team by taking full accountability for personal workload, ensuring work is completed to a high standard in accordance with site policies, procedures and applicable regulations

Requirements

  • National 4 Award or Higher in Maths

Background

  • Proven warehouse experience
  • Ability to operate forklift, hand truck, pallet jack and other warehouse equipment
  • Solid understanding of health and safety regulations
  • Knowledge of MS Office, in particular Excel and ERP Systems
  • Good organization skills; manage quality documentation, execution of order placement and other administrative duties in a timely manner
  • Good communication skills - written and oral, working with other departments, effective preparation of documents and reports
  • Be able to work as a member of a small team
  • Not required, however an understanding in the requirements of the handling of dangerous goods by air and/or road is advantageous
